Fashion Victims
In the fast-paced world of global fashion, the pursuit of low-cost, high-volume production often comes at a hidden, human cost. This investigative documentary pulls back the curtain on the supply chains of major retail giants, exposing the stark reality behind the clothes on our shelves. Through undercover footage and direct confrontation with corporate leadership, the film reveals the systemic exploitation of vulnerable workers in developing nations, where child labor and hazardous working conditions are often the price paid for the latest trends. It is a compelling look at the disconnect between corporate social responsibility pledges and the harsh, often dangerous, realities faced by those who make our clothes.
